Borrowing Tips for Coral Springs
- Do not focus solely on the monthly payment; evaluate the total cost of the loan including interest and fees.
- Consider gap insurance if your down payment is less than 20%; it covers the difference if your car is totaled.
- Refinance your auto loan after 12-18 months of on-time payments if your credit score has improved significantly.
